Empowering Small Businesses: Key Use Cases for Management Software Solutions

Small enterprises are the backbone of many economies, but they often face unique challenges when it comes to managing their day-to-day operations. This is where management software solutions come in, offering a powerful way to streamline processes, boost efficiency, and ultimately drive growth. A key use case for these programs is customer relationship management (CRM). By centralizing customer data and automating tasks like contact, businesses can build stronger relationships and provide a more personalized experience. Inventory management is another crucial area where software can make a significant difference. Real-time tracking of stock levels, automated reordering, and integrated sales data help reduce stockouts and enhance inventory turnover.

For many small businesses, finances are a constant worry. Accounting software can automate tasks like invoicing, expense tracking, and financial reporting, freeing up time for owners to focus on other aspects of the business. By providing valuable data into financial performance, these tools can also help businesses make more informed decisions about pricing, spending, and expansion.

In conclusion, management software solutions are essential tools for empowering small businesses. From CRM to inventory management and accounting, these applications offer a wide range of benefits that can help enterprises thrive in today's competitive marketplace.

The Many Applications of Business Management Software

Business management software has become essential for organizations of all sizes. From streamlining customer relations to managing website finances, these versatile tools empower businesses to improve their operations and achieve greater efficiency. One of the most popular applications of business management software is CRM systems, which streamline customer relationship management. By centralizing customer data, tracking interactions, and automating processes, CRMs help businesses build stronger relationships with their customers and drive growth.

In addition to CRM, accounting software is another vital component of a comprehensive business management suite. Automated accounting systems streamline tasks such as invoicing, expense tracking, and financial reporting, providing businesses with real-time insights into their monetary performance.

Moreover, business management software can also encompass a range of other functionalities, such as project management tools, inventory control systems, and human resources applications. By integrating these different modules, businesses can create a cohesive and productive system for managing all aspects of their operations.

Selecting the Right Business Management Software for Your Needs

Finding the optimal business management software can be a complex challenge. With a plethora of choices available, it's crucial to carefully analyze your specific requirements. A comprehensive solution should streamline various aspects of your operations, such as budgeting, client interaction, and delivery.

Before embarking on your software quest, define your objectives. Determine which tools are mandatory for your company. For instance, if you prioritize automation, look for software with robust tasks and linkage capabilities.

Consider the size of your business and the number of users who will be employing the software.

Additionally, assess your allocation. Compare pricing models and choose a platform that offers cost-effectiveness. Don't hesitate to obtain trials from different software providers to evaluate their platforms firsthand.
